Razor is good aswell, not to mention harmless and harmor by image line. I also prefer Sytrus to FM8, more flexibility and I've found it works better with ohmicide. I'm currently working on replicating Scatta-type growls with it.Today wrote:those r the only 2 real dubstep instruments obvz
Poizone is a good subtractive synth that's awesome for old school wobbles. Zeta+ and Sylenth are amazing for leads, plucks and arps.
